实现Python Logger数据读取
一、流程概述
下面是实现“Python logger数据读取”的流程表格:
步骤 | 操作 |
---|---|
1 | 导入logging模块 |
2 | 配置Logger对象 |
3 | 设置Logger级别 |
4 | 添加Handler |
5 | 读取Logger数据 |
二、具体操作步骤
步骤一:导入logging模块
首先,在Python中,我们需要导入logging模块,它是Python自带的日志模块,用于记录程序运行时的信息。
import logging
步骤二:配置Logger对象
然后,我们需要配置Logger对象,Logger是logging模块中最基本的对象,用于生成日志记录。
logger = logging.getLogger('my_logger')
步骤三:设置Logger级别
接着,我们需要设置Logger对象的级别,级别分为DEBUG、INFO、WARNING、ERROR、CRITICAL,可以根据需要设置不同级别。
logger.setLevel(logging.DEBUG)
步骤四:添加Handler
然后,我们需要为Logger对象添加Handler,Handler用于控制日志记录的发送方式,比如输出到控制台或写入文件。
handler = logging.FileHandler('my_log.log')
logger.addHandler(handler)
步骤五:读取Logger数据
最后,我们可以通过Logger对象来记录日志信息,在需要记录日志的地方,使用Logger对象的相应方法即可。
logger.debug('This is a debug message')
logger.info('This is an info message')
logger.warning('This is a warning message')
logger.error('This is an error message')
logger.critical('This is a critical message')
三、总结
通过以上步骤,我们成功实现了Python Logger数据读取。记住,在实际应用中,可以根据具体需求调整Logger的配置和记录方式,以便更好地监控程序运行情况。
gantt
title 实现Python Logger数据读取甘特图
section 配置Logger
导入logging模块 : done, a1, 2022-01-01, 1d
配置Logger对象 : done, a2, after a1, 1d
设置Logger级别 : done, a3, after a2, 1d
添加Handler : done, a4, after a3, 1d
section 读取Logger数据
读取Logger数据 : done, b1, after a4, 1d
希望以上内容能帮助你顺利实现Python Logger数据读取,如果有任何疑问,欢迎随时向我提问!